Start by bringing a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add your choice of pasta, such as penne, and cook according to the package instructions. Remember to stir occasionally to prevent sticking. Once cooked, drain and set aside.
While the pasta is cooking,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add 1 diced onion and 3 minced garlic cloves. Sauté them until they become fragrant and translucent, which should take about 3-4 minutes.
Next, add 1 pound of boneless ch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ces, to the skillet. Cook until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through, approximately 6-8 minutes. Stir occasionally to ensure even cooking.
Once the chicken is cooked, pour in ½ cup of your favorite hot sauce. For a milder flavor, you can adjust the amount to your liking. Let it simmer for about 2-3 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ully.
Now, it’s time to bring everything together! Add the drained pasta to the skillet with the chicken mixture. Toss everything gently to combine. If you want a creamier texture, stir in 1 cup of shredded cheese, such as mozzarella or cheddar, until melted and well incorporated.
Finally, serve your Spicy Buffalo Chicken Pasta hot. Garnish with freshly chopped parsley and an extra sprinkle of cheese, if desired. This dish is perfect for a cozy family dinner!
